Wood cladding repair services involve the assessment and restoration of exterior or interior wooden panels that serve as protective or decorative siding on buildings. Skilled professionals evaluate the condition of the existing cladding, identifying issues such as rot, warping, cracking, or insect damage. Repairs may include replacing damaged sections, sanding and refinishing surfaces, or applying protective coatings to restore the wood’s appearance and structural integrity. These services aim to improve the durability of the cladding while maintaining or enhancing the aesthetic appeal of the property.

Addressing common problems like moisture infiltration, decay, and physical damage is a primary focus of wood cladding repair.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wood to deteriorate, leading to compromised insulation and increased vulnerability to further damage. Repair services help prevent the escalation of these issues by restoring the wood’s protective qualities, reducing the risk of leaks, mold growth, and structural weakening. Proper repair work can extend the lifespan of the cladding and help maintain the overall stability of the building envelope.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for wood cladding repair services can range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age and the size of the area. Smaller repairs, such as replacing individual boards, tend to be at the lower end of the spectrum. Larger projects involving extensive damage may require a higher investment.

Material Expenses - Material costs for wood cladding repair vary based on the type of wood and quality selected, generally between $2 and $10 per square foot. Premium woods or custom finishes can increase overall expenses. These costs are in addition to labor charges from local service providers.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for repairing wood cladding typically range from $50 to $100 per hour, influenced by the complexity of the work and local rates. A small repair might take a few hours, while larger projects could span multiple days.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include surface preparation, painting or staining, and weatherproofing, which can add $200 to $800 to the overall price. These services help protect the repaired wood and extend its lifespan, with costs varying by project scope and material choice.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my wood cladding needs repair? Signs such as rotting, warping, cracking, or visible damage may indicate the need for repair services. A local contractor can assess the condition of the cladding to determine necessary work.

What types of repairs are common for wood cladding? Common repairs include replacing damaged boards, sanding and refinishing surfaces, sealing gaps, and addressing moisture-related issues to restore appearance and integrity.

How long does wood cladding repair typically take? Repair durations vary based on the extent of damage and the scope of work. A local service provider can provide an estimated timeline after an assessment.

Is it possible to prevent future damage to wood cladding? Regular maintenance such as sealing, cleaning, and inspecting for early signs of damage can help preserve wood cladding. A local contractor can recommend suitable preventative measures.
